Output c59d64d7160bd6269dc0ec86109ad209198b27d76d1ae728acb2813176bfbc02: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c21dda0d8f054045c6c1fa587f8c6df12bf6855 OP_EQUAL
address
37Ay35x2Qe1e49CipLG8v9jiTS33Q7Bbxb
transaction
c59d64d7160bd6269dc0ec86109ad209198b27d76d1ae728acb2813176bfbc02
confirmations
264382
spent
true